[QUOTE="teitan, post: 278155, member: 3457"] Currently Warg Rider Studios has begun developing a D20 game of WAHOO action adventure in the Flash Gordon, STar Wars and Buck Rogers sense. High Octane action kind of stuff. I am inquiring to see if there is a market for this cinematic four color approach within the D20 Market. This is not an attempt at Pulp Action as we think that Forbidden KIngdoms has that covered very nicely. We will also take advantage of some OGC rules that are currently in print like some of the Dragonstar stuff. SOme products highlights include: A core rulebook called WAHOO!!! or some such, not yet set in stone. This would detail the adjustments to the D20 system that make this sort of action possible within the system, like critical skills and action dice etc. Prolly clock in at 180 pages including starship combat rules and variant combat and damage rules. Fey Kingdoms is a near future campaign setting for the rules detailing a future Earth where Elves and Dragons have returned. Basic idea is that the Unseelie court has broken down the barrier between our world and the world of the faerie races and made war with mankind. The Elves have returned to the material plane to teach man the use of magic and help them overcome the Unseelie COurt. The campaign starts 100 years after the initial breaking of the barrier by the Unseelie COurt. THink Flash GOrdon meets Dungeons & Dragons. Not a post apocalyptic sort of thing. A mega adventure for Fey Kingdoms that details the initial breakdown of the barrier 100 years previous and the humans first battles with the Unseelie servants. Think of the line as being similar in scope to SPycraft, a cool set of rules to set the tone for a genre within the D20 system. As we have just begun development we are about a year off from a released product but it never hurts to look into interest ahead of time. Like a lot of D20 products it may just be vapor ware. Oh and those interested in the previously discussed Unlimited Power SUpers system, the development has halted on that because the system we were developing is very similar to other systems being developed by various publishers and many of the variants for it are being integrated into WAHOO!!! Jason R. Carpenter, Director Warg Rider STudios [/QUOTE]
